The foundation of any server is the Half-Life Dedicated Server (HLDS). A fixed server almost always uses HLDS Build 6153 (or the newer 8684 protocol 48). Older builds (like 4554) are prone to the "hlds crash on map change" bug. A fixed build includes pre-patched files that remove the outdated Steam authentication bottlenecks.

The phrase "gata facut" seems to be Romanian in origin. When translated to English, it roughly means "already done" or "ready made." In the context of a CS 1.6 server, this could imply a server that is pre-configured or fully set up and ready for use, possibly with specific settings, plugins, or modifications already implemented.
